Nice, I just ordered a Sapphire 7870. I read a great review over at hardware heaven and it seems that the Sapphire runs very cool and its trading blows with the 7950. I am taking a big chance with this card so I hope that Nvidia doesn't blow this purchase out of the water. I guess I can just refuse delivery.
FWIW, read an article a while back on some European site talking about the DC2 cooling system having poor contact with the GPU on the 7950 leading to overheat. Not sure if that's applicable to the 7870, but it does appear to use a similar design.
